The introduction of advanced energy-saving technologies brought to the forefront of progress the new device domestic purposes - Ultrasonic ultrasound ustroystvo.Stirka erasing occurs due to periodic formation of the bulk liquid compression-expansion waves that occur in virtually incompressible medium - water. Linen placed in a liquid is subjected to intensive hydroacoustic impact. Hydroacoustic waves initiate the microscopic appearance of gas bubbles that contribute to the separation of dirt microparticles volume of laundry. In the formation and subsequent collapse (destruction) of the gas bubbles formed ozone sterilizing linen. In some cases, when high energy ultrasonic vibrations, can be observed sonoluminescence - the glow of fluids, especially noticeable in a darkened room.

The advantage of washing using ultrasonic vibrations is that underwear is not deformed, no mechanical wear and tear. You can even wash woolen products, and fine linen. In addition to washing and disinfecting the laundry, can be processed fruits and vegetables, intended for conservation decontaminated water.

Appeared on the market ultrasonic washing device [1] (UZSU) of "Bionics" is a compact electrical device weighing 200 g "Bionics" is made up of a network adapter - power supply and proper UZSU. The device itself in order to preserve the "know-how" encapsulated, and a description of its concept and is not important for playback characteristics. However, having obtained by measuring and analyzing device modes secondary characteristics, can present one of the possible schemes UZSU as follows (Figure 1).

ultrasonic washing machine scheme

UZSU consists of a power supply (DA1 chip), two interconnected generators operating at frequencies of 10 kHz and 1 MHz (DD1 chip), the output stage transistor VT1 and activator-emitter connected to points C and D devices. The power supply is made in the prototype unregulated, calculated on the maximum power consumed by the network - 3 watts, which is enough to wash the laundry in the volume of fluid 10 ... 25 liters. It seems more appropriate to ensure UZSU continuously adjustable output power. Figure 1 in the gap between the points A and B included an adjustable source of stabilized DC (25 ... 1000 mA). Figure 2 shows a diagram of a regulated power supply (5 ... 13). Packet Generator impulses executed by traditional pattern on the chip DD1 and has no singularities. The values ​​of the elements RC-frequency part of the generator can be adjusted when adjusting the frequency in resonance with the frequency of the ultrasonic transmitter-activator. DA1 and chip transistor VT1 must be installed on the heat sink plates.

The most problematic in a practical implementation choice UZSU ultrasonic transducer and activator ensuring its sealing while achieving maximum benefit ultrasound energy into the environment (fluid). Typically, the ultrasound transducer used piezoceramic - barium titanate, strontium, radiators on ferrite or permalloy cores, Quartz crystal plate (Figure 3) [2-4], which opens up a wide field for experiment. One of the interesting options for obtaining the ultrasonic vibration is simply the transmission of electrical current pulses through the water with the use of closely spaced electrode system connected to points A and B devices. The periodic passage of current pulses between the electrodes will cause acoustic elektrostimulirovannuyu modulation solution. The electrodes can be recommended as aluminum or graphite. When washing reliable isolation from the mains supply must be ensured. Washing tank (bucket pelvis) must be removed from the grounded object and mounted on a dry floor. Acoustic vibrations in the erasure solution can be excited in the audio frequency range. Experiments have shown that the washing takes place under such conditions as compared with an acceptable result with the prior art.

Features washing with UZSU - in erasing the same solution was poured erasing powder as hand-washing, the water temperature should be about 65 ° C. Linen should float freely in solution, occasionally it should stir a wooden tongs. Heavily soiled areas of laundry soap is recommended further. washing process lasts for 30 ... 40 minutes or more (depending on the efficiency of the ultrasonic activator). Rinse the laundry is possible and using UZSU. It should be noted that the experience of optimal use UZSU appears after a few washes.
